Home Savings’ service feat to save soles for children
STAFF REPORT
WARREN — Three Home Savings Trumbull County offices have joined forces to save soles.
Between Monday and Nov. 26, the Eastwood, Howland and McDonald branches of Home Savings are working together on Project: Saving Soles, for which they will be collecting new or gently worn athletic and tennis shoes to benefit Children’s Rehabilitation Center, 885 Howland-Wilson Road, Howland.
The center is dedicated to providing rehabilitation services, facilities, and information to children and their families in Mahoning, Trumbull and Columbiana counties, specializing in neurological and orthopedic needs.
Each pair of shoes will be fitted with orthotics to aid with rehabilitation therapy.
